Job Description: Speech-Language Pathologist Assistant (SLPA)
Achieve Speech and Language Services, PLLC is a well-established, SLP-owned and operated practice that has been serving the communication needs of children and families in the Greater Houston area for over 20 years. With a reputation for excellence and a commitment to personalized care, our practice continues to grow. We currently operate from our main office in Atascocita and have recently expanded to a new location in Spring. To support this growth, we are seeking a passionate, motivated, and skilled Spanish-speaking bilingual Speech-Language Pathologist Assistant (SLPA) to join our friendly and collaborative team at the Atascocita location.
Responsibilities and Duties:
- Implement individualized therapy programs under the supervision of licensed Speech-Language Pathologists (SLPs) to address speech, language, voice, and feeding issues.
- Assist in the preparation and maintenance of patient records, documenting treatment plans, progress, and outcomes.
- Provide direct therapy to patients in individual or group settings, under the direction of the supervising SLP.
- Provide feedback to patients, families, and caregivers regarding patient progress and areas requiring further development.
- Assist in the development of therapy materials and tools tailored to each patients needs.
- Support the management of feeding and oral function programs as well as myofunctional therapy.
- Work closely with a multidisciplinary team, including physicians, dentists, behavior analysts, and other specialists, to ensure comprehensive patient care.
- Collaborate with the SLP to monitor and adjust therapy plans based on patient progress and needs.
- Assist with the implementation of aug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) systems.
- Maintain professional, compassionate communication with patients and their families.
-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local regulatory requirements in speech therapy practice.
- Keep up-to-date with the latest developments in the field of speech-language pathology through continuing education and professional development.
Qualifications and Skills:
- Completion of an accredited Speech-Language Pathology Assistant (SLPA) program or equivalent, with a focus on assisting in the treatment of speech, language, and feeding disorders.
- Minimum of 1 year of relevant experience as a practicing SLPA in a pediatric clinical setting preferred; strong new graduates with clinical practicum experience will also be considered.
- Fluent in Spanish and English; must be Spanish-speaking bilingual.
- Ability to work under the supervision of a licensed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P).
- Str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to establish rapport with patients and families and provide compassionate care.
- Detail-oriented with the ability to maintain accurate and thorough documentation.
- A passion for working with pediatric and/or adult populations with diverse needs.
- Knowledge of basic clinical techniques and procedures in speech-language pathology.
- Knowledge of HIPAA regulations and confidentiality requirements.
Certifications and Licenses:
- Current Texas Speech-Language Pathology Assistant License.
- Must meet state regulatory requirements for speech-language assistant practice.
- ASHA (American Speech-Language-Hearing Association) certification or eligibility is preferred but not required.
